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Prudhoe to St Columb Road start from as little as £70.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Prudhoe to St Columb Road start from £159.70 one way, or £293.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Prudhoe to St Columb Road are available for £301.00 one way, or £533.40 return

Exploring the Station Facilities

At Prudhoe Station, convenience is key, even though you won’t find a traditional ticket office here. Instead, passengers are welcomed by user-friendly ticket machines that allow for the easy collection of tickets purchased online. These machines are conveniently accessible for everyone, providing card-only transactions for a seamless experience. While the station may lack a staff presence, help is still at hand via a dedicated helpline numbered 08002006060, where trained advisors are ready to assist with any queries.

Accessibility is thoughtfully integrated, with step-free access available to both platforms via a level crossing, ensuring a smooth transition from arrival to departure. Furthermore, passengers who are traveling in wheelchairs or require added assistance can feel at ease knowing that the station caters to their needs.

Onward Journeys from Prudhoe

Prudhoe Station isn't just a point of departure—it's a hub of connectivity. With bus services operating nearby and a taxi service facilitated through Northern's Cab4You, getting to and from the station couldn't be easier. Should the need arise for rail replacement services, they're conveniently located at the bus interchange in the station's car park. For those favoring a more adventurous route, consider pedaling through the surrounding area, though note that bicycle hire isn't available from the station itself.

Station Facilities: Keeping It Simple

St Columb Road station boasts a straightforward design with essential amenities to make your journey convenient. While there isn't a ticket office or ticket machines on-site, you can plan ahead by purchasing and downloading tickets through the GWR app or website. The station is designed with accessibility in mind, offering a fully step-free platform and assistance from help points. Wi-Fi is available through GWR's free station service, ensuring you stay connected as you embark on your journey.

Transport Links and Accessibility

Access to St Columb Road is grounded in its simplicity. The station connects seamlessly to other transportation modes, including rail replacement services found at the adjacent car park. Although taxis aren't directly available at the station, information about local bus services can be printed directly from here. There's also provision for cyclists with on-platform storage stands for your bike.
